On the KDE desktop, right-click the panel, point to Panel Options, select Add Widget, and add the Pager widget. ![]() On GNOME Shell, you can open the Activities overview and manage workspaces from there. On the Cinnamon desktop offered in Linux Mint, right-click the panel, select Add applets to the panel, and add the Workspace switcher from the list.
